Transaction d229f7016731f7484295b66e6547552e39a46a492ee1177bd7f8111388147271

1 Input
2 Outputs
  • d229f7016731f7484295b66e6547552e39a46a492ee1177bd7f8111388147271:0
  • value  264707
    address  1K6CXtMqpjmdu7eAJ2KZ6AC2kmHcfA9QMc
  • d229f7016731f7484295b66e6547552e39a46a492ee1177bd7f8111388147271:1
  • value  5336077068
    address  3QBEjSdESMK2puAvs7J8d15e8SBnsX1pN1